- 1、本文档共1002页,可阅读全部内容。
- 2、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
- 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载。
- 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
查看更多
2. 交换机的交换方式 交换机的实现技术主要有两种,一种是直接交换方式,另一种是存储转发交换方式。 (1) 直接交换方式:在这种交换方式中,交换机只读出网络帧的前14个字节,便将数据帧传输到相应的端口上。在输入端口检测到一个数据帧时,首先检查该数据帧的帧头,获取帧的目的地址,然后启动内部的动态查找表将目的地址转换成相应的输出端口,最后把数据帧直通到相应的端口,实现交换功能。由于直接交换方式不需要存储,所以无法判断数据包是否有误,也不提供错误检测能力,不能将具有不同速率的输入、输出端口直接接通,而且容易丢包。但是这种交换方式的传输延迟非常小,交换速度快。 (2) 存储转发交换方式:在这种交换方式中,交换机首先完整地接收发送来的帧,并进行差错检测。如果帧是正确的,就根据帧的目的地址确定输出端口号,再转发出去。这种交换方式的优点是具有帧差错检测能力,并能支持不同输入/输出速率的端口之间的帧转发。缺点是交换延迟较大,且随转发帧的长短而有所不同,特别是在网络负载较重时,交换机内有限的缓冲区很快会被塞满,造成后续帧的丢失,使得传输速率下降。不过现在的交换机采用了一种“背压”的控制技术来解决这个问题,即当交换机内的缓冲空间快满时,它会自动发出拥塞信号,从而造成冲突的假象,使发送结点停止发送,避免了帧的丢失。 3. 交换机的特点 以太网交换机实质上就是一个多端口的网桥,工作在数据链路层,其特点如下: (1) 交换机上每个端口独占带宽,对于一台16个端口10 M的交换机,总带宽为16?×?10?=?160 M,同时交换机还支持全双工通信。 (2) 交换机不仅对数据的传输起到同步、放大和整形的作用,而且还能在数据传输过程中过滤短帧、碎片等,不会出现数据包丢弃、传输延时等现象,保证了数据传输的正确性。 (3) 交换机检测到某一端口发来的数据包,根据其目标地址,查找“端口-地址”表,找到相应的目标端口,打开源到目的端口之间的数据通道,将数据包发送到对应的目标端口上。当不同的源端口向不同的目标端口发送信息时,交换机可以同时互不影响地传送这些信息包,并防止传输碰撞,隔离冲突域,有效地抑制广播风暴,提高网络的吞 吐量。 (4) 交换机的维护比较简单,通过交换机上的指示灯就能确定哪些端口上的计算机网卡或网线存在故障,并予以排除。 4. 交换机的分类 交换机可以有多种类型,具体如下: (1) 按应用的网络类型,交换机可以分为以太网交换机、FDDI交换机与ATM交换机等。 (2) 根据交换机所完成的功能在OSI模型中的层次,交换机可以分为第二层交换机、第三层交换机与第四层交换机。 ① 第二层交换机:属于数据链路层设备,可以识别数据包中的MAC地址信息,根据MAC地址进行转发,并将这些MAC地址与对应的端口记录在自己内部的一个地址表中,具有低交换传输延迟、高传输带宽的特点。 ② 第三层交换机:利用交换技术实现第三层的功能。三层交换机的最重要目的是加快大型局域网内部的数据交换,所具有的路由功能也是为这目的服务的,能够做到一次路由,多次转发。对于数据包转发等规律性的过程由硬件高速实现,而像路由信息更新、路由表维护、路由计算、路由确定等功能,由软件实现。三层交换技术就是二层交换技术?+?三层转发技术。传统交换技术是在OSI网络标准模型第二层——数据链路层进行操作的,而三层交换技术是在网络模型中的第三层实现了数据包的高速转发,既可实现网络路由功能,又可根据不同网络状况做到最优网络性能。 ③ 第四层交换机:第四层交换机不仅可以完成端到端交换,还能根据端口主机的应用特点,确定或限制它的交换流量。简单地说,第四层交换机是基于传输层数据包的交换过程的,是一类基于TCP/IP协议应用层的用户应用交换需求的新型局域网交换机。第四层交换机支持TCP/UDP第四层以下的所有协议,可识别至少80个字节的数据包包头长度,可根据TCP/UDP端口号来区分数据包的应用类型,从而实现应用层的访问控制和服务质量保证,第四层交换机是一类以软件技术为主,以硬件技术为辅的网络管理交换设备。 (3) 按照网络构成方式来分,交换机可以分为核心层交换机、汇聚层交换机和接入层交换机。 ① 核心层交换机:采用机箱式模块化设计,主要用在大型网络的核心层。 ② 汇聚层交换机:是多台接入层交换机的汇聚点,是连接核心层和接入层的中间层。 ③ 接入层交换机:允许终端用户连接到网络。 通常,人们会把交换和路由进行对比,这主要是因为在普通用户看来两者所实现的功能是完全一样的。其实,路由和交换之间的主要区别就是交换发生在OSI参考模型的第二层(数据链路层),而路由发生在第三层,即网络层。这一区别决定了路由和交换在移动信息的过程中需要使
文档评论(0)